/ / Các hoạt động phi viết mã giúp nâng cao kỹ năng của nhà phát triển

Các hoạt động phi viết mã giúp nâng cao kỹ năng của nhà phát triển

Có một giả định rằng viết nhiều mã hơn sẽ khiến bạn trở thành một lập trình viên giỏi hơn. Mặc dù điều đó có thể đúng, nhưng các buổi viết mã kéo dài có thể gây mệt mỏi và thất vọng. Điều này có thể dễ dàng dẫn đến kiệt sức ảnh hưởng đến chất lượng đầu ra của bạn.


Nghỉ giải lao giữa các phiên lập trình. Phá vỡ sự đơn điệu làm mới cơ thể và tâm trí của bạn. Tham gia vào các hoạt động kích hoạt cơ thể của bạn có thể giúp cải thiện kỹ năng lập trình. Bạn có thể kết hợp các hoạt động sau vào thói quen của mình để nâng cao kỹ năng mã hóa của mình.


1. Chơi trò chơi điện tử

Một số nghiên cứu đã liên kết trò chơi điện tử với các tác động tiêu cực. Tuy nhiên, các nghiên cứu khác cho thấy rằng bạn có thể trải nghiệm những lợi ích về nhận thức từ việc chơi game. Viện Quốc gia về Lạm dụng Ma túy (NIH) cho thấy trò chơi điện tử có thể cải thiện hiệu suất nhận thức.

Trong một nghiên cứu được thực hiện trên trẻ em, các nhà nghiên cứu đã đánh giá tác động đối với các kỹ năng nhận thức. Nghiên cứu đã so sánh những đứa trẻ chơi trò chơi điện tử với những đứa trẻ không chơi.

ai đó đang chơi trò chơi điện tử

Kết quả cho thấy những đứa trẻ chơi trò chơi điện tử kiểm soát tốt hơn các cơn bốc đồng của chúng. Họ cũng có thể ghi nhớ nhiều thông tin hơn và thực hiện các nhiệm vụ nhanh hơn. Nghiên cứu không chỉ áp dụng cho trẻ em. Nó cho thấy cách con người sử dụng các kỹ năng trong trò chơi để lập chiến lược và lập kế hoạch cho các tình huống thực tế.

Là một lập trình viên, bạn có thể nâng cao kỹ năng mã hóa của mình trong khi vui chơi. Chọn các trò chơi điện tử chiến lược cho phép bạn suy nghĩ, lập kế hoạch và giải quyết vấn đề. Những kỹ năng này sẽ giúp bạn khi thiết kế và lập chiến lược cho các yếu tố phát triển trong khi viết mã.

2. Đọc một cuốn sách hay

Đọc cải thiện khả năng tinh thần của mọi người, bao gồm cả các lập trình viên. Và điều này không bao gồm hướng dẫn lập trình và tài liệu. Cố gắng tìm tài liệu đọc hoàn toàn khác với công việc lập trình của bạn, chẳng hạn như tiểu sử hoặc tiểu thuyết.

ai đó đọc trong khi cầm cốc uống

Một bài báo của Thư viện Y khoa Quốc gia gợi ý rằng đọc tiểu thuyết giúp tăng cường trí não. Nó đánh giá khả năng kết nối của não bộ trong khoảng thời gian khi các cá nhân đọc và khi họ không đọc. Các nhà nghiên cứu đã quan sát thấy sự gia tăng kết nối trong não trong suốt thời gian đọc. Trong các phiên không đọc, kết nối bị từ chối.

Nghiên cứu này cho thấy các lập trình viên có thể củng cố các tế bào não của họ bằng tài liệu hư cấu. Việc tăng khả năng hiểu sẽ giúp ích khi nhà phát triển quay lại các hoạt động viết mã. Các tài liệu hư cấu, như khoa học viễn tưởng, có thể thúc đẩy sự sáng tạo trong thiết kế, từ vựng và các yếu tố lập trình.

Có rất nhiều trang web cho phép bạn tải sách miễn phí.

3. Tập thể dục cơ thể của bạn, không chỉ tâm trí của bạn

Tập thể dục thường xuyên tăng cường năng lực thể chất và tinh thần của bạn để đối phó với căng thẳng. Lập trình viên cần khả năng tinh thần mạnh mẽ để đối phó với những thách thức của công nghệ phần mềm.

Trung tâm Kiểm soát và Phòng ngừa Dịch bệnh (CDC) báo cáo tập thể dục làm giảm căng thẳng. Nó cũng thúc đẩy sự cân bằng cảm xúc. Giữ cho cơ thể bạn hoạt động giúp tăng cường khả năng học tập, suy nghĩ và giải quyết vấn đề của bạn.

người phụ nữ tập thể dục trên thảm

Một nghiên cứu của CDC đã đánh giá những người trưởng thành tích cực và những người không tích cực. Nó phát hiện ra rằng những người trưởng thành năng động có sức khỏe tinh thần tốt hơn. Mặt khác, những người trưởng thành không hoạt động có sự suy giảm nhận thức sâu rộng. Họ có nguy cơ mắc các bệnh tâm thần như mất trí nhớ cao hơn.

Các lập trình viên có thể chọn các bài tập uốn cong toàn bộ cơ thể, đặc biệt là lưng, cổ và ngực. Đây là những cơ bị ảnh hưởng nhiều nhất khi các lập trình viên có xu hướng ngồi trong một thời gian dài. Có một số ứng dụng thể dục tuyệt vời có thể giúp bạn cải thiện sức khỏe tổng thể của mình. Chúng bao gồm chế độ ăn uống, hydrat hóa và lịch trình ngủ của bạn.

4. Viết Về Những Điều Bạn Biết

Viết giúp tăng cường đáng kể khả năng giao tiếp của bạn với tư cách là một nhà phát triển. Các nhà phát triển hiện được yêu cầu tạo tài liệu cho mã của họ. StackOverflow báo cáo rằng các kỹ sư dành 70-90% thời gian của họ để tạo tài liệu.

ai đó viết trong một cuốn sách

Viết kỹ thuật liên quan đến việc chia nhỏ các khái niệm kỹ thuật phức tạp thành các giải thích đơn giản. Nó giáo dục mọi người về công nghệ và chỉ ra cách sử dụng các sản phẩm và phần mềm. Cách tốt nhất để học là dạy. Các nhà phát triển có thể tìm hiểu các khái niệm sâu hơn bằng cách giải thích chúng cho những người khác.

Viết tài liệu kỹ thuật có thể là một vấn đề nếu bạn không tham gia lớp học viết. May mắn thay, bạn có thể học viết kỹ thuật và thậm chí xây dựng sự nghiệp trong đó. Hướng dẫn viết kỹ thuật của Google có thể dạy cho bạn những kiến ​​thức cơ bản về viết kỹ thuật. Trên blog của mình, tôi thà viết, Tom Johnson cung cấp một hướng dẫn thực tế về cách viết API cho người mới bắt đầu.

5. Kết nối với người khác

Mạng liên quan đến việc trao đổi kiến ​​thức và ý tưởng. Nó cung cấp cơ hội hoàn hảo để học hỏi từ những người khác. Theo tạp chí Forbes, mạng lưới giúp bạn tạo dựng các mối quan hệ công việc và các mối quan hệ lâu dài.

Mạng làm cho các kỹ năng của bạn được chú ý, từ đó thúc đẩy triển vọng nghề nghiệp. Bạn tìm hiểu thêm tại các sự kiện công nghệ, gặp gỡ những người tuyệt vời và thăng tiến trong các cơ hội nghề nghiệp. Khi kết nối mạng, hãy chọn các sự kiện và những người mà bạn có thể cùng có lợi. Đây có thể là các hội nghị công nghệ, hackathons và các diễn đàn truyền thông xã hội như Twitter.

6. Nói trước công chúng

Nói trước công chúng là một cách tuyệt vời để thể hiện ý tưởng của bạn với khán giả mục tiêu. Nhưng nó không dễ dàng. Nói trước công chúng là một trong những kỹ năng hiếm có nhất mà mọi người có được. Nó đòi hỏi sự luyện tập và lòng tự trọng cao.

Tuy nhiên, học cách nói trước công chúng sẽ giúp bạn diễn đạt ý tưởng của mình một cách rõ ràng. Điều này có thể hữu ích khi ủng hộ các cơ hội trong cuộc sống của bạn. Ví dụ, quản lý tốt hơn tại nơi làm việc và cải thiện điều kiện ở nhà.

cái mic cờ rô

Theo trang web việc làm của Indeed, nói trước công chúng là một kỹ năng chất lượng cao mà mọi người nên có. Nó cải thiện phong cách trình bày, sự hiện diện và sự tự tin của bạn. Diễn giả giỏi thu hút khán giả thông qua giao tiếp rõ ràng. Họ có sức thuyết phục và có tổ chức.

Bạn sẽ cần kỹ năng nói trước công chúng để chia sẻ ý tưởng và khuyến khích tư duy phản biện. Nó giúp các nhà phát triển trình bày các chiến lược giải quyết vấn đề trong các cuộc họp. Phát âm rõ ràng làm tăng số lượng người lắng nghe bạn và mức độ tương tác của bạn. Điều này, đến lượt nó, mang đến cơ hội cho mạng xã hội và nghề nghiệp.

Một trong những cách tốt nhất để cải thiện kỹ năng nói trước đám đông là luyện tập. Tận dụng mọi cơ hội để nói trước mọi người; với thời gian, nó có vẻ tự nhiên. Có những ứng dụng có thể giúp bạn cải thiện khả năng nói trước đám đông. Tham gia các tổ chức diễn thuyết trước công chúng như Toastmasters sẽ giúp ích rất nhiều. Họ tổ chức các hoạt động tương tác và cơ hội để phát biểu cũng như nhận phản hồi về tiến trình của bạn.

Tại sao các lập trình viên nên tích cực

Viết các dòng mã trong một thời gian dài có thể khiến bạn kiệt sức về thể chất và tinh thần. Bạn cần dành thời gian để thư giãn và làm mới bản thân, trừ khi bạn là người máy!

Ngoài các hoạt động được đề cập ở đây, bạn có thể thực hiện nhiều hoạt động khác. Đồ gỗ, vẽ và chơi nhạc có thể là những sở thích tuyệt vời để xem xét

Các hoạt động xen kẽ giúp giảm bớt sự nhàm chán. Cân nhắc tham gia vào một hoạt động không viết mã hàng ngày và xem liệu bạn có nhận thấy sự cải thiện hay không. Hy vọng rằng bạn thậm chí sẽ thích viết mã hơn trước đây.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*